Kentucky forests and parks are full of incredible beauty each season, but fall is a special time of year. The shades of red, orange, gold, and brown are stunning as the trees change into to their autumn colors. Some states do not benefit from the seasonal changes quite like the Bluegrass State. We are blessed with an amazing array of shades during our fall, with each leave as unique as a snowflake.
